Output 8d68c28e4dbb9008b08d7469cfe5d5630d91529c17347a776ecb4cf2f2dc32f2:1

value
2237198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53e3fbcadde93c1bac7eb484f4a186d8f58cc473 OP_EQUAL
address
39Lb83McXjjQhozuYvjuMA99KCQoDVYy71
transaction
8d68c28e4dbb9008b08d7469cfe5d5630d91529c17347a776ecb4cf2f2dc32f2
confirmations
387324
spent
true